回报率如何查看数据库

回报率如何查看数据库

查看数据库回报率的核心步骤包括:分析数据库性能指标、监控数据库使用情况、优化数据库查询、利用数据库管理工具。其中,分析数据库性能指标是最关键的一步,这可以帮助你了解数据库的当前状态和潜在问题,并为进一步的优化提供数据支持。

一、分析数据库性能指标

分析数据库性能指标是查看回报率的第一步。性能指标包括查询响应时间、吞吐量、CPU使用率、内存使用率和磁盘I/O等。这些指标能帮助你了解数据库的运行状况,找出瓶颈和需要优化的地方。

1.1 查询响应时间

查询响应时间是衡量数据库性能的重要指标之一。它表示从数据库接收到查询请求到返回结果所需的时间。可以通过监控工具如New Relic、AppDynamics等查看响应时间。如果发现响应时间过长,可能需要优化查询语句或调整数据库索引。

1.2 吞吐量

吞吐量是指数据库在单位时间内处理的请求数量。高吞吐量通常表明数据库能高效处理大量请求。可以通过数据库自带的性能监控工具如MySQL的Performance Schema或PostgreSQL的pg_stat_statements查看吞吐量。

1.3 CPU和内存使用率

CPU和内存使用率也能反映数据库的性能。高CPU使用率可能表示数据库处理大量复杂查询,而高内存使用率可能表明数据库缓存较多数据。可以使用系统监控工具如top、htop、vmstat等查看这些指标。

二、监控数据库使用情况

监控数据库使用情况是确保其高效运行的关键。通过持续监控,可以及时发现并解决性能问题,确保数据库的稳定性。

2.1 使用数据库管理工具

数据库管理工具如PingCodeWorktile可以帮助你实时监控数据库性能。这些工具提供了丰富的监控和报告功能,可以帮助你轻松查看和分析各种性能指标。

2.2 定期检查日志文件

数据库日志文件记录了数据库运行过程中的各种事件,包括查询执行情况、错误信息等。定期检查日志文件,可以帮助你发现潜在问题并采取相应措施。

三、优化数据库查询

优化数据库查询是提高数据库回报率的重要手段。通过优化查询,可以减少响应时间,提高系统吞吐量。

3.1 使用适当的索引

索引是提高查询性能的重要手段。通过为常用查询字段创建索引,可以显著提高查询速度。但是,索引也会占用存储空间和增加写操作的开销,因此需要合理设计索引。

3.2 避免不必要的复杂查询

复杂查询不仅会增加响应时间,还会占用大量系统资源。尽量简化查询语句,避免使用不必要的子查询和联表操作,可以提高查询性能。

四、利用数据库管理工具

利用数据库管理工具可以大大简化数据库管理工作,提高管理效率。

4.1 使用PingCode进行研发项目管理

PingCode是一款专业的研发项目管理系统,可以帮助你高效管理研发项目。通过PingCode,可以轻松查看和分析数据库性能指标,及时发现并解决性能问题。

4.2 使用Worktile进行项目协作

Worktile是一款通用项目协作软件,适用于各种类型的项目管理。通过Worktile,可以方便地进行团队协作,提高项目管理效率。特别是在数据库管理项目中,Worktile可以帮助你协调团队成员,共同解决数据库性能问题。

五、定期进行性能测试

定期进行性能测试可以帮助你了解数据库的当前状态,发现潜在问题并采取相应措施。

5.1 制定性能测试计划

制定性能测试计划,包括测试频率、测试内容和测试方法等。通过定期进行性能测试,可以及时发现并解决数据库性能问题。

5.2 使用性能测试工具

性能测试工具如JMeter、LoadRunner等可以帮助你进行全面的性能测试。通过这些工具,可以模拟大量用户访问数据库,测试数据库在高负载下的性能表现。

六、总结

查看数据库回报率是一个综合性的工作,需要从多个方面进行分析和优化。通过分析数据库性能指标、监控数据库使用情况、优化数据库查询、利用数据库管理工具和定期进行性能测试,可以有效提高数据库的回报率。特别是使用PingCode和Worktile这样的专业工具,可以大大简化数据库管理工作,提高管理效率。希望本文的内容能对你查看和优化数据库回报率有所帮助。

相关问答FAQs:

1. 如何在数据库中查看回报率?
回报率是指投资所获得的收益与投资成本之间的比例。要在数据库中查看回报率,您可以按照以下步骤操作:

  • 首先,登录到您的数据库管理系统。
  • 其次,选择您想要查看回报率的数据表或视图。
  • 然后,使用SQL查询语句计算回报率。您可以使用投资收益除以投资成本,并将结果乘以100以获得百分比形式的回报率。
  • 最后,执行查询并查看回报率的结果。

2. 数据库中的回报率如何对比不同投资项目之间的表现?
如果您想要比较不同投资项目的回报率,可以按照以下步骤进行操作:

  • 首先,选择您要比较的不同投资项目的数据表或视图。
  • 其次,使用SQL查询语句计算每个投资项目的回报率,如上一条FAQ中所述。
  • 然后,将每个投资项目的回报率结果进行比较,以确定哪个投资项目的回报率更高或更低。
  • 最后,根据比较结果做出相应的决策或调整投资策略。

3. 如何利用数据库中的回报率数据进行数据分析和预测?
利用数据库中的回报率数据进行数据分析和预测可以帮助您做出更明智的投资决策。以下是一些步骤和技巧:

  • 首先,收集足够的历史回报率数据,并将其存储在数据库中。
  • 其次,使用数据分析工具或SQL查询语句来提取和处理回报率数据,以获得更有洞察力的信息。
  • 然后,利用统计分析方法和机器学习算法,对回报率数据进行建模和预测。
  • 最后,根据预测结果评估投资风险和收益,并调整投资策略以获得更好的回报率。

原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1855334

(0)
Edit1Edit1
上一篇 4天前
下一篇 4天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部